A guy in Kansas named Steven Gibbs is selling a machine he makes and calls the Hyper Dimensional Resonator, or HDR for short.
He says by using this machine and standing in a proper vortex area you CAN physically time travel! Even take your car along!!! He claims he has gone back to 1977 and purchased some books from then that PROOVE what he says is true. Now yoiu have to keep in mind that he says as soon as your traveling in time you wind up on another dimension by proxy......he claims the books from 1977 he brought back are from another dimension and not available in OUR TIMEFRAME AT ALL and this is how they proove the veracity of his claims.

Steven was on Coast to Coast January 10th 2008, and I listened to this interview and I was fascinated, as what he was saying sounded true to me.
He says his HDR device will cause you to have an OOBE pretty easily and you all know how interested in THAT subject I am! I want to get me one of these HDR things but they cost a few hundred USA dollars, so it is going to take me a while to save up for this thing.
Other people who have the device were also interviewed and all the people claimed VERY STRANGE experiences with this thing. Claims of time jumping forward and back, of realizing your watching a movie on TV you know VERY well but the lines are suddenly so different it is almost a different movie and you know your NOT imagining this.......then it goes back to normal. Weird time jumps like this are very common they claim......They referred to Steven Gibbs as 'The Rainman of time travel'
Gibbs says that even the adult John Titor bought one of his devices

Steven says some people have used this HDR to go back in time to prevent car wrecks or other tragic deaths, but when you come back there will be large gaps in your memory baseline because you have now changed your timeline..........

This is all very interesting to me. This device sounds much like a handheld version of 'whatever device' they used in the Philadelphia experiment

Some guy on MTV has even bought 2 of the HDR devices now and experiments with them.....I think if the device did NOT work then why would this guy buy a 2nd one???

Steven Gibbs gives NO GARUNTEE whatsoever on his device. No moneyback garuntee about you being able to time travel or anything but he was claiming his device WORKS......
